Zest Business Group is seeking an Optical Assistant in Borehamwood. The role involves delivering exceptional patient care, supporting frame styling, and managing appointments.
As part of a forward-thinking optical practice, you will work in a modern environment with advanced technology. The position offers a competitive salary of up to £28,000 and opportunities for professional growth.
